Job Description

Position profile: The Kensington and Area Chamber of Commerce (KACC) seeks a dynamic team-player passionate about community to join our non-profit organization as our Project Coordinator for a project entitled “Planning for Resilience in Rural Business Communities”. This limited-term position is primarily responsible for managing and leading the delivery of an exciting new project focused on strengthening resilience to improve mental well-being in our community. Project development will be in collaboration with the Executive Director. Secondary duties include general office administration and providing day-to-day administrative support for the organization. Successful applicants may negotiate acceptable hybrid working conditions.

Duties/Responsibilities Project:

  • Lead the KACC planning for Resilience in Rural Business Communities’ project including scope statement, schedule, budget, requirements and quality criteria.
  • Initiate and plan professional development sessions in collaboration with the Executive Director and respective Committee Members.
  • Launch and execute approved sessions in accordance with the approved plan and within the project timeline.
  • Implement and control plan tasks including progress reports established in the project plan.
